Got this one Friday morning. He was after a doe.

Several years back, I bought a CVA Wolf at WalMart for about $100. I didn't expect much, but found that with 2 777 pellets and 295 grain Powerbelt bullets, it would shoot unbelievably small groups, and has since taken a lot of deer. Since it breaks down like a single barrel shotgun, it's also easy to clean. It also has a very good trigger.

My only complaint with this rifle is the latch that opens the receiver. It is large, and protrudes below the triggerguard, which makes it prone to being bumped on things and partially opening the action. Short of that, I am amazed with this gun for the price.
